How the formula works
Both imperial hundredweight per imperial gallon and long ton per cubic meter measure the same physical quantity (mass per unit volume), so converting between them is a single multiplication. Multiply a value in imperial hundredweight per imperial gallon by 10.998462 to get long ton per cubic meter. To reverse the conversion, multiply a long ton per cubic meter value by 0.090922 to get back to imperial hundredweight per imperial gallon.
